Internal Rate Return
A financial metric used to estimate the profitability of potential investments, calculated as the discount rate that makes the net present value (NPV) of all cash flows from the investment equal to zero.
Cash Flows
The collective sum of funds moving in and out of a company, impacting its liquidity and general financial stability.
